KH Gangwon Development Pursues Acquisition of Alpensia Resort
[Asia Economy Reporter Hyungsoo Park] KH Philux and KH Electron jointly invested in KH Gangwon Development, which announced on the 24th that it has been finally awarded the bid for the sale of Pyeongchang Alpensia Resort.
A basic agreement for the transfer and acquisition of Alpensia Resort was signed at the Gangwon Provincial Government Office. KH Gangwon Development was so determined to acquire the resort that it participated from the first round of bidding. Over the past year, significant efforts were made in terms of manpower and costs for acquisition preparation and development planning.
Han Woo-geun, CEO of KH Gangwon Development, said, "The location of Alpensia Resort has significantly less yellow dust and fine dust compared to other regions," adding, "We will strengthen the existing resort business and develop it into the best resort in South Korea."
He continued, "In addition to the prestigious 45-hole Alpensia CC and the two 700GC golf courses, we plan to build additional golf courses, an outdoor swimming pool, and an ice rink facility."
He also emphasized, "We will develop 116,000 pyeong of idle land and purchase an additional approximately 400,000 pyeong of adjacent land, then attract outlets linked with the existing resort," adding, "We will create a four-season resort where the whole family can enjoy and heal by developing a new concept animal and plant theme park and an Alps-themed village."
Regarding the succession of employment for executives and staff, CEO Han said, "We will do our best to stabilize employment through 100% employment succession of Alpensia employees," and "Labor and management will create a pleasant workplace through mutual dialogue and harmony."
KH Gangwon Development has acquired Alpensia Resort and established a strategy to generate profits by offering differentiated premium services under the theme of a ‘complex shopping and cultural space where everything can be resolved in one place,’ setting it apart from other resorts.

They expect significant profits by purchasing and developing adjacent land. The KH Group, to which KH Gangwon Development that acquired Alpensia Resort belongs, acquired the Grand Hyatt Seoul in 2019. With assets totaling approximately 2 trillion won, they are confident in mobilizing sufficient financial resources for the acquisition of Alpensia Resort.
